c1910 French Renee Lalique Perfume bottles. Selling both substantial Renee<br>Lalique perfume bottles from the first quarter of the 20th century. The one on<br>the right, Violette D'Orsay's glass is made by Baccarat and the Metal Lalique.<br>It's marked with the Crown RL mark in the metal which I did a bad job showning.<br>It's a well documented but very scarce bottle that has surfaced at both Heritage<br>and Rago's Auction in excess of 2k. Debans Atomizer on the left which I didn't<br>attempt to use but the bottom of the bronze atomizer hose looks like it may be<br>stopped up. They measure 5" and 5 3/8" tall. No chips, cracks, or restorations.<br>TW60
